Have you done any testing on the drive itself?

I once had an HDD that appeared fine and I didn't suspect a hardware issue at first because I was only getting non-descript errors in the OS. It turned out it was physical errors on the drive.

If you've not done any disk testing, try burning yourself a Hiren CD and running one of the disk testing utilities (like teskdisk) to see how healthy it is.

Error Oxcoooooe9 generally means an unexpected I/O error has been occurred. This generally means an issue with the hard drive. I would suggest testing your hard drive with "Seagate Seatool".

1. Make sure SATA mode is set to IDE in BIOS setup. Otherwise DOS based tools won't see your HDD.

2. Download and burn Seatool for DOS from the below link.

SeaTools for DOS | Seagate

3. Boot from the disc and perform a "Long Test".

seatools-2.png



Let us know whether the test is a PASS or FAIL.
